What is a part time unlicensed insurance agent?

A Part Time Unlicensed Insurance Agent is someone who assists with insurance-related tasks without holding an official insurance license, and typically works fewer hours than a full-time employee. Their duties may include administrative work, customer service, scheduling appointments, and supporting licensed agents. They are not allowed to sell, solicit, or negotiate insurance policies directly with clients. This role is often an entry point into the insurance industry and can lead to opportunities for obtaining a license and advancing into a licensed agent position.

What are some common challenges faced by part time unlicensed insurance agents, and how can they overcome them?

Part-time unlicensed insurance agents often face challenges such as limited access to certain sales opportunities, since they cannot legally sell or discuss specific insurance products without a license. They may also experience slower career progression compared to licensed agents. To overcome these challenges, it's helpful to focus on administrative, customer service, or lead generation tasks, and to seek mentorship from licensed colleagues. Additionally, pursuing licensure while working can open up more responsibilities and advancement opportunities in the field.

How you make a difference

As a Registered Nurse (RN), your primary responsibility is to provide patient care using the nursing process of assessment, planning, implementation, and evaluation. You will work under the supervision of Charge Nurse(s) to provide patient education and activities in accordance with your competencies and education. This role requires excellent communication and critical thinking skills to ensure optimal patient outcomes. 

Key Responsibilities
  • Assist in assessing and planning individual treatment programs, consulting with Charge Nurse(s) and other staff as necessary. 
  • Implement medical plans by administering medications, obtaining diagnostic tests, and assisting with medical or minor surgical procedures as needed. 
  • Count controlled substances and implement clinical and technical aspects of care in accordance with established policies, procedures, and protocols. 
  • Document nursing encounters using the SOAP form of charting as required by policy and attend mandatory staff meetings and training. 
  • Communicate information to nursing staff, physician, health care unit supervisory personnel or other staff as necessary.
